I'm a content provider myself so when I say I exclusive I mean 100% exclusive with no limitations in terms of media or timeframe. It's a direct transfer of the rights to the content.
The situation you're describing could result from:
1) The CP you dealt with sold you a 3- or 6- month exclusive (a lot of reputable CPs do that - for example, Zmasters). So it's a fair game - just check your license.
2) The CP got his content stolen and a "broker" is reselling it. I don't think this is very likely because it's much harder to steal exclusive content than regular zipped galleries hosted online.
3) The CP is trying to make a quick buck on the side hoping no one will notice.
I suggest you approach both the CP and the broker and compare versions. THEN post it here so we know who's to blame.
